Mayor Demings issues an Emergency Executive Order for Orange County

Today, July 28, 2021, under the Orange County Charter, as acting Director of Emergency Management, I announced and signed Executive Order 2021-24, declaring a State of Local Emergency for Orange County. The Executive Order strongly considers the data from Orange County health care providers that have experienced an increase in emergency room visits, hospitalizations, and deaths related to COVID-19...

Fla.’s Housing Market: Sales, Median Price, More Rise in June

Florida’s housing market continued the same trends as previous months with more closed sales, higher median prices and more new listings compared to a year ago, according to Florida Realtors® latest housing data. Condo Owners Now Wondering: “What Does My Insurance Cover?

It’s complicated. A condo dweller could be covered by three separate types of policies. Who pays – and how much – may take time to sort out. The disastrous collapse of the Champlain Towers South condo in Surfside has panicked condo owners across Florida who fear their insurance policies wouldn’t protect them against a financial catastrophe.
